As a consequence of its central spot, it?�s very easily available from other parts of town.|Busan is found around the southeastern idea in the Korean Peninsula. It is located to the coast, which determined the event of The entire town itself. The space from Busan to Seoul is about 314 km (195 mi). Busan borders lower mountains for the north and west, plus the Korea Strait on the south and east. Ilgwang Seashore is a lengthy white-sand beach, extending for around one.eight kilometers, and is especially well-liked amid people with young youngsters being a holiday vacation spot because the waters are really shallow.

120 meters high and built in the nineteen seventies with extensive renovations in 2021, Busan Diamond Tower is open up until 10pm every night this means you can find sublime sunset sights of Busan port plus the close by hills.
